Yamaha, the well renowned two-wheeler manufacturer is now planning to grab the Indian scooter market with the launches of its scooters in India. The company announced the introduction of the scooters in the Indian market at the Auto Expo 2010, New Delhi. The world’s largest gear-less scooter maker, the Yamaha Motor Company, Japan, with a range of scooters from 50 cc to 500 cc, has started studying the Indian market in order to introduce and make its models successful.Yamaha, the two-wheeler company that has already been excelling in the world of bikes is now ready to test its luck with the scooters in the Indian market. At first the enterprise will be making available its three scooters namely Yamaha -50 cc Neo, Yamaha 115cc Fino and the Yamaha 135cc Spark to the selected dealers with respect to measure the response from the Indian buyers.
